Lamarck's
Pertains to Lamarckism, a theory of evolution that emphasizes the inheritance of acquired characteristics.
Darwin's Mechanism
A theory proposed by Charles Darwin that describes the process of natural selection as the mechanism by which evolution takes place.
Modern Synthesis Theory
A framework that merges Darwinian evolution with Mendelian genetics, explaining how evolutionary processes like natural selection act on genetic variation.
Amino Acid Substitutions
Changes in the protein sequence where one amino acid is replaced by another, potentially altering protein function or stability.
